Output 89d6376d4ee72707557d98015866758ca54f1f0aab7a2a865e07373ffeadd8ff:3

value
9870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1daa68171c064e50cedeba8287bc815d8d3db31 OP_EQUAL
address
3HuRTbSycBTLaBnP2m2W185q21dpGGE8Sy
transaction
89d6376d4ee72707557d98015866758ca54f1f0aab7a2a865e07373ffeadd8ff